Output 09d3b103ae6625d49f41379cd4f13cdb1e88e211b1bd2010c8803811e1973486:0

value
14389304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1516b6b4991785b48392fc5e2e819673f05139d OP_EQUAL
address
3Hrb4dZN7nztY7h1ssSGJDv2jusWoKpgWq
transaction
09d3b103ae6625d49f41379cd4f13cdb1e88e211b1bd2010c8803811e1973486
spent
true